Why Pai Gow Poker Works for Aussie Players on a Budget
Here’s the thing about pai gow poker. It’s slow. That’s not a bug, it’s a feature. You get more play for your dollar compared to blackjack or roulette. The house edge is lower too, around 2.5% if you play smart. For Aussies who want to stretch a deposit, this game is a godsend.
I’ve seen players burn through a hundred bucks in five minutes on pokies. On pai gow, that same hundred can last an hour or more. Especially if you find tables with low minimums. And that’s exactly what I was looking for.
Most live casinos let you bet as low as $5 or $10 per hand. Some even go down to $1. That’s rare, but it exists.

What’s the house edge for pai gow poker?
Around 2.5% if you play the banker hand. It’s one of the lowest in the casino. Compare that to roulette which is 5.26% on double zero.
Do I need to tip the dealer?
No. But they appreciate it. Some casinos let you place a “tip bet” for the dealer. I usually throw them a dollar or two if I’m winning.
Is there a strategy for pai gow poker?
Sort of. The basic rule is to set your hand so the front hand is weaker than the back hand. If you’re unsure, most tables have a “house way” button that sets it automatically. I use that when I’m tired.
Can I play with friends?
Some tables allow multiple players. But it’s not like poker where you compete against each other. Everyone plays against the dealer. It’s more social than competitive.
